case AF_UNIX:
|
||
|
|
+ // this strncpy call originally could piss off an address
|
||
|
|
+ // sanitizer; we supplied the size of the dest buf as a limiter,
|
||
|
|
+ // but optimized versions of strncpy could read past the end of
|
||
|
|
+ // *src while looking for a null terminator. Since buf and
|
||
|
|
+ // sun_path here are both on the stack they could even overlap,
|
||
|
|
+ // which is "undefined". In all OSS versions of strncpy I could
|
||
|
|
+ // find this has no effect; it'll still only copy until the first null
|
||
|
|
+ // terminator is found. Thus it's possible to get the OS to
|
||
|
|
+ // examine past the end of sun_path but it's unclear to me if this
|
||
|
|
+ // can cause any actual problem.
|
||
|
|
+ //
|
||
|
|
+ // We need a safe_strncpy util function but I'll punt on figuring
|
||
|
|
+ // that out for now.
